Skip to content

Commit b06fffa

Browse files
gusibigusibi
authored andcommitted
update change log
1 parent a4506e9 commit b06fffa

File tree

6 files changed

+411
-72
lines changed

6 files changed

+411
-72
lines changed

.github/workflows/release.yml

Lines changed: 67 additions & 68 deletions
Original file line numberDiff line numberDiff line change
@@ -72,89 +72,88 @@ jobs:
7272
cat > RELEASE_NOTES.md << 'EOF'
7373
# MoliTodo v${{ steps.get_version.outputs.VERSION }} ✨
7474
75-
## 🎉 正式版本发布 - AI 报告生成系统重磅上线
76-
77-
MoliTodo v1.0.0 正式版本隆重发布!这是一个具有里程碑意义的版本,标志着 MoliTodo 从简单的任务管理工具进化为智能化的工作效率助手。
78-
79-
### 🤖 AI 智能报告生成系统 (AI Report Generation System)
80-
81-
#### 核心功能特性
82-
- **一键生成工作报告**: 基于现有强大的 AI 基础设施,新增智能报告生成功能
83-
- **多AI提供商支持**: 利用 OpenAI、Google Gemini、Anthropic Claude、xAI Grok 等顶级 AI 服务
84-
- **智能内容分析**: AI 深度分析任务状态、时间分布、完成情况,生成专业级工作报告
85-
- **自定义报告模板**: 支持个性化的日报和周报模板配置,满足不同工作场景需求
86-
- **Markdown 格式输出**: 生成结构化的 Markdown 格式报告,易于分享和存档
87-
88-
#### 智能特性亮点
89-
- **时间筛选集成**: AI 报告按钮无缝集成到时间筛选组件,基于当前筛选上下文生成相应报告
90-
- **智能报告类型判断**: 根据筛选条件自动判断生成日报还是周报
91-
- **任务状态精准识别**: 基于任务的 status 字段精确判断任务状态和进度
92-
- **一键复制功能**: 生成的报告支持一键复制到剪贴板,便于即时使用
93-
- **加载状态反馈**: 完善的加载动画和状态提示,确保用户体验流畅
94-
95-
### 🎯 1.0.0 里程碑意义
96-
97-
#### 功能生态系统完善
98-
- **AI 生态闭环**: 从任务创建到报告生成,形成完整的 AI 驱动工作流
99-
- **企业级应用**: 报告生成功能使应用具备企业级工作场景适用性
100-
- **智能工作助手**: 从简单任务管理进化为智能化工作效率助手
101-
- **行业领先地位**: 在任务管理应用中率先实现智能报告生成
102-
103-
#### 技术架构成熟度
104-
- **微服务化实现**: 报告服务的独立化体现了架构的成熟
105-
- **扩展性基础**: 为未来更多 AI 功能奠定了坚实基础
106-
- **稳定性保证**: 经过多个版本迭代,架构稳定可靠
107-
- **性能优化**: 达到企业级应用的性能要求
108-
109-
## 📚 使用指南
110-
111-
### 快速开始
112-
1. **配置 AI 服务**: 在设置页面配置至少一个 AI 提供商
113-
2. **自定义模板**: (可选)在 AI 设置中自定义报告模板
114-
3. **筛选任务**: 使用时间筛选选择要分析的任务范围
115-
4. **生成报告**: 点击 AI 报告按钮,选择 AI 模型并生成
116-
5. **查看和复制**: 在弹窗中查看报告内容,一键复制使用
117-
118-
### 模板定制
119-
- **占位符语法**: 使用 `{{变量名}}` 语法定义动态内容位置
120-
- **支持变量**: `{{project_name}}`、`{{report_period}}`、`{{summary}}`、`{{completed_tasks}}` 等
121-
- **Markdown 格式**: 模板支持完整的 Markdown 语法格式化
122-
- **预览功能**: 配置过程中实时预览模板效果
75+
## 🥚 隐藏功能彩蛋发布 - 数据库任务详情视图
76+
77+
MoliTodo v1.0.2 带来了一个特殊的隐藏功能,专为开发者和高级用户设计。这个彩蛋功能提供了对应用数据存储层的完整透明访问,让您能够深入了解任务数据的内部结构。
78+
79+
### 🍎 macOS 用户重要提示
80+
81+
由于应用未经过 Apple 开发者认证,macOS 用户在首次运行或每次更新后可能需要执行以下命令来移除系统隔离限制:
82+
83+
```bash
84+
sudo xattr -rd com.apple.quarantine /Applications/MoliTodo.app
85+
```
86+
87+
**执行时机**:
88+
- 首次安装后
89+
- 每次应用更新后
90+
- 遇到"无法打开应用程序"提示时
91+
92+
**操作步骤**:
93+
1. 打开终端(Terminal)
94+
2. 复制粘贴上述命令
95+
3. 输入管理员密码确认
96+
4. 重新启动 MoliTodo
97+
98+
### 📥 下载和安装
99+
100+
### 🎯 彩蛋激活方式
101+
102+
**连续点击 5 次鼠标**即可激活隐藏的数据库视图功能!这个特殊的触发机制为应用增添了探索的乐趣。
103+
104+
### 📊 数据库详情视图核心特性
105+
106+
#### 完整数据展示
107+
- **原始数据库字段**: 展示所有任务的原始数据库字段,包括内部元数据和系统字段
108+
- **表格化布局**: 专业的表格设计,数据层次清楚,支持分页浏览
109+
- **字段完整性**: 显示包括 `id`、`content`、`status`、`metadata`、`recurrence` 等所有数据库字段
110+
- **复杂字段查看**: JSON 字段和长文本提供专门的详情弹窗查看
111+
112+
113+
### 🔍 使用指南
114+
115+
#### 激活方法
116+
1. **找到触发区域**: 在应用的任何位置都可以激活彩蛋
117+
2. **连续点击**: 用鼠标快速连续点击 5 次
118+
3. **功能激活**: 成功激活后会自动显示数据库视图模态框
119+
4. **浏览数据**: 使用分页控件浏览所有任务数据库记录
120+
5. **查看详情**: 复杂字段点击"查看详情"按钮查看完整内容
121+
122+
#### 功能特色
123+
- **只读访问**: 提供只读的数据访问,确保不会意外修改数据
124+
- **完整展示**: 展示任务在数据库中的真实存储格式
125+
- **开发友好**: 为开发者和技术用户提供有价值的内部视图
126+
- **教育意义**: 帮助理解现代 Web 应用的数据架构设计
123127
124128
## 🔄 升级说明
125129
126-
### 兼容性保证
127-
- **完全向后兼容**: 现有所有数据和配置完全保留
128-
- **AI 配置复用**: 利用现有 AI 配置,无需重新设置
129-
- **功能增强**: 在现有功能基础上新增报告功能,不影响原有工作流程
130-
- **即时可用**: 有 AI 配置的用户升级后立即可使用新功能
130+
### 无缝集成
131+
- **零影响升级**: 彩蛋功能对现有功能无任何影响
132+
- **可选发现**: 功能完全可选,不干扰正常使用流程
133+
- **数据安全**: 只提供只读访问,确保数据安全
134+
- **性能中性**: 不使用时对主应用无性能影响
131135
132-
### 性能提升
133-
- **响应优化**: 改进 AI 调用的响应时间和用户反馈
134-
- **内存效率**: 优化报告生成过程的内存使用
135-
- **并发处理**: 优化多个报告生成请求的并发处理
136+
### 兼容性保证
137+
- **完全向后兼容**: 所有现有数据和配置完全保留
138+
- **功能增强**: 在现有功能基础上新增调试功能
139+
- **即时可用**: 升级后立即可以尝试彩蛋功能
136140
137-
## 🚀 未来展望
138141
139-
v1.0.0 的发布标志着 MoliTodo 进入了新的发展阶段。基于这个强大的 AI 报告生成系统,我们将继续探索更多智能化功能:
140142
141-
- **语音报告生成**: 通过语音指令快速生成报告
142-
- **团队协作报告**: 支持团队级别的协作报告生成
143-
- **数据可视化**: 将报告数据转化为图表和可视化内容
144-
- **预测性分析**: 基于历史数据的工作趋势预测
143+
## 🙏 社区感谢
145144
146-
## 🙏 致谢
145+
感谢所有好奇和探索的用户!正是因为有您们的支持和探索精神,我们才能不断创新,为应用添加这样有趣且有价值的功能。
147146
148-
感谢所有用户的支持和反馈,特别是那些积极使用 AI 功能并提供改进建议的用户。正是大家的参与和建议,使得 MoliTodo 能够不断进化,成为今天这样强大的智能工作助手
147+
这个彩蛋功能不仅是一个技术展示,更是我们与用户建立更深层连接的方式。我们相信透明度和开放性是构建优秀软件的基础
149148
150149
---
151150
152-
**立即体验**: [下载 MoliTodo v1.0.0](https://github.com/${{ github.repository }}/releases/tag/v${{ steps.get_version.outputs.VERSION }})
153-
**功能文档**: [AI 报告生成使用指南](https://github.com/${{ github.repository }}/blob/main/docs/releases/v1.0.0.md)
151+
**立即体验**: [下载 MoliTodo v${{ steps.get_version.outputs.VERSION }}](https://github.com/${{ github.repository }}/releases/tag/v${{ steps.get_version.outputs.VERSION }})
152+
**功能文档**: [数据库视图使用指南](https://github.com/${{ github.repository }}/blob/main/docs/releases/v${{ steps.get_version.outputs.VERSION }}.md)
154153
**问题反馈**: [GitHub Issues](https://github.com/${{ github.repository }}/issues)
155154
**社区讨论**: [开发者论坛](https://github.com/${{ github.repository }}/discussions)
156155
157-
**MoliTodo v1.0.0 - 让智能成为工作效率的新标准!**
156+
**MoliTodo v${{ steps.get_version.outputs.VERSION }} - 探索数据的奥秘,发现隐藏的惊喜!🥚**
158157
EOF
159158
- uses: softprops/action-gh-release@v2
160159
with:

CHANGELOG.md

Lines changed: 68 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,74 @@ All notable changes to MoliTodo will be documented in this file.
55
The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
66
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
77

8+
## [1.0.2] - 2025-09-09
9+
10+
### 🥚 隐藏功能 (Easter Egg)
11+
12+
#### 📊 数据库任务详情视图 (Database Task Details View)
13+
- **彩蛋触发机制**: 连续点击 5 次鼠标激活隐藏的数据库视图功能
14+
- **完整数据库视图**: 显示任务的所有原始数据库字段,包括内部元数据和系统字段
15+
- **表格化展示**: 采用专业的表格布局展示所有任务数据,支持分页浏览
16+
- **详细字段显示**: 展示包括 `id``content``status``metadata``recurrence` 等所有数据库字段
17+
- **复杂字段查看**: 对于复杂的 JSON 字段和长文本,提供专门的详情弹窗查看
18+
19+
#### 数据库视图核心特性
20+
- **TaskDetailsModal 组件**: 全新的数据库视图模态框,提供完整的任务数据展示
21+
- **智能字段识别**: 自动识别简单字段和复杂字段,提供不同的展示方式
22+
- **分页导航系统**: 支持大量任务数据的分页浏览,每页显示 10 条记录
23+
- **字段详情查看**: 复杂字段(JSON、长文本)支持点击查看详细内容
24+
- **响应式设计**: 完美适配不同屏幕尺寸,确保数据清晰可读
25+
26+
#### 开发者友好特性
27+
- **数据库字段映射**: 显示中英文字段名对照,便于理解数据结构
28+
- **原始数据展示**: 展示任务在数据库中的真实存储格式
29+
- **调试辅助工具**: 帮助开发者和高级用户了解应用内部数据结构
30+
- **系统透明度**: 提升应用数据处理的透明度和可观测性
31+
32+
### ✨ UI/UX 改进
33+
34+
#### 数据库视图界面设计
35+
- **专业表格布局**: 采用现代化的表格设计,数据层次清晰
36+
- **主题适配支持**: 完美支持明暗主题切换,保持视觉一致性
37+
- **滚动条优化**: 自定义滚动条样式,适配不同操作系统
38+
- **加载状态管理**: 大量数据加载时的优雅加载状态显示
39+
40+
#### 字段详情弹窗
41+
- **JSON 格式化显示**: 复杂的 JSON 数据自动格式化,便于阅读
42+
- **代码风格展示**: 采用等宽字体和语法高亮风格显示数据
43+
- **多层模态框支持**: 支持在主模态框基础上再次打开详情模态框
44+
- **键盘快捷键**: 支持 ESC 键快速关闭模态框
45+
46+
### 🛠️ 技术实现
47+
48+
#### 组件架构设计
49+
- **Vue 3 Composition API**: 采用最新的 Vue 3 组合式 API 构建
50+
- **响应式数据处理**: 高效处理大量任务数据的响应式更新
51+
- **内存优化**: 分页机制确保大量数据时的内存使用效率
52+
- **类型安全**: 完整的字段类型检查和安全的数据访问
53+
54+
#### 数据处理优化
55+
- **智能字段分类**: 自动识别和分类不同类型的数据库字段
56+
- **格式化引擎**: 智能格式化不同类型的数据值(时间戳、布尔值、JSON等)
57+
- **性能优化**: 虚拟滚动和懒加载机制,确保大数据量时的流畅体验
58+
- **错误处理**: 完善的数据访问错误处理和降级显示
59+
60+
### 🎯 用户价值
61+
62+
#### 数据透明度提升
63+
- **系统洞察**: 让用户深入了解应用的数据存储和处理机制
64+
- **调试辅助**: 为用户排查问题提供底层数据视图
65+
- **学习价值**: 帮助开发者用户理解现代任务管理应用的数据模型
66+
- **信任建立**: 通过数据透明度建立用户对应用的信任
67+
68+
#### 高级用户体验
69+
- **专业工具**: 为高级用户和开发者提供专业级的数据查看工具
70+
- **探索乐趣**: 彩蛋机制增加应用的探索乐趣和惊喜感
71+
- **定制需求**: 为有特殊需求的用户提供原始数据访问能力
72+
- **问题诊断**: 在遇到问题时可以查看底层数据状态
73+
74+
---
75+
876
## [1.0.0] - 2025-09-07
977

1078
### 🎉 正式版本发布 - AI 报告生成系统重磅上线

0 commit comments

Comments
 (0)